About the role

The Insurance Verifier/Estimator is responsible for verifying insurance authorizations for new patients and ensuring eligibility for services. Additional duties include collecting insurance information, notifying patients of estimated charges, and documenting interactions with patients and insurance companies.

INSURANCE VERIFIER/ESTIMATOR-Surgery Center Full Time

Summary of Position

Verify all new patients’ insurance authorizations both primary and secondary payors.

Verify accuracy of data entry for all new patients.

Ensure that all information is gathered and Latern referral is appropriate for the care being potentially provided.

Verify the patient is eligible for service(s) and prior approval has been granted before initiating services.

Provide necessary paperwork to accurately bill accounts; and other duties as assigned.

Collect insurance policy IDs and verifying benefits and checking price estimates for procedures scheduled.

Notify patients of estimated charges based on claims processed to date.

Explain patient’s deductibles and out of pocket expenses as necessary.

Document all contact with patients, doctors, and insurance companies in NextGen

Pre-registration and registration of patients, receiving and directing incoming calls.

Communicate to physician and team regarding patient information

Responsible for alerting vendors of implant needs

Order lunch for physician daily

This role is also the back up person to the front desk.
